Wagering Requirements and House Edge Minimisation

From a pure probability standpoint, wagering is the enemy of value. Every time you spin through a bonus, the house edge eats into your expected return. A 10x wagering requirement on a slot with 96% RTP means you lose around 4% of the bonus value per wagering cycle. That isn’t terrible, but a 40x requirement on the same slot bleeds 40% of the bonus before you see a penny. Avoid those like the plague.

KYC verification was handled by a compliance software provider called Onfido across several sites. The process was straightforward: upload a passport or driving licence, take a selfie, and wait for the automated check. Most approvals came through within 15 minutes. A few required manual review, which added a couple of hours. If you want to avoid delays, verify your account before you deposit.
